body { background-color:#E5D29E; background-image:url(images/bg1.jpg); margin:0 0 0 0 ; padding:0 0 0 0 ; }

#container { display:block; width:780px; height:inherit; background-color:#D3D2B6; padding:0; margin:0 auto; font-size:12px; border-left:3px solid #D3D2B6; border-right:3px solid #D3D2B6;/* border-bottom:0px;*/ }

#top { width:780px; height:9px; background-color:#E6E1C6; margin:0 auto; padding:3px 0; }
#top h3 { font-family:Arial, Helvetica, sans-serif; font-size:10px; color:#393939; text-align:center; margin:0; padding:0; /*text-transform:uppercase;*/ }
/*#top h1 { text-indent:-99999px; margin:0; padding:0;}
#top h2 { text-indent:-99999px; margin:0; padding:0;}*/

#navlist {width:780px; height:226px; margin:0px; padding:0; background-image:url(images/header_1.jpg); border-bottom:20px solid #AA7000; /*position:absolute; z-index:300; top:150px; left:50%; margin-left:-390px;*/}
/*#navtext h1 { width:240px; height:20px; background-image:url(../images/nav_header.jpg); font-family:Georgia, Arial, Serif; font-weight:bold; font-size:18px; color:#EFE2BF; padding:5px 0 5px 50px; text-align:left; text-transform:uppercase; margin:0 0 10px 0;}
#navtext ul { font-family: Tahoma, Verdana, Arial Helvetica, sans-serif; font-size:13px; margin:10px 0 30px 0; padding:0; }
#navtext li { color:#c54b1d; list-style-image:url(../images/arrows.gif); margin:5px 0px 0 25px; padding:0; }
#navtext a { color:#c54b1d; text-decoration:underline; margin:0; padding:0; }
#navtext a:hover { color:#663300; margin:0; padding:0; }
#navtext a:active { color:#ffffff; margin:0; padding:0; }*/

#navcontainer { width:220px; height:inherit; margin:0 0 0 25px; padding:0; float:left;}
#navcontainer ul {	margin-left: 0;	padding-left: 0;	list-style-image:url(images/arrows.gif);	font-family: Verdana, Arial, Helvetica, sans-serif;	font-size: 11px;	font-weight: bold;}
#navcontainer li { border-bottom: 1px solid Gray; }
#navcontainer a {	display: block;	padding: 4px 4px 4px 4px;	width: 215px;	font-family: Verdana, Arial, Helvetica, sans-serif;}
#navcontainer a:link, #navlist a:visited {	color: #657C1E;	text-decoration: none;}
#navcontainer a:hover {	background-color:#DCDCDC;	color: #AA7000;}
#navlist a:link#current {	text-shadow: 2px 2px 3px #551302;	background: #932104;	color: White;}

#navhyp { float:left; width:345px; height:226px; margin:0; padding:0; }
#navhyp a { position:relative; top:200px; left:208px; font-size:12px; color:#000000; text-transform:capitalize; }

#navsearch { float:left; width:180px; height:inherit;}
#navsearch p { margin:15px 0 0 0; }
#navsearch td { line-height:22px; font-size:11px; font-family:Arial, Helvetica, sans-serif; }
#navsearch a {color:#FFFFCC;}

#header { display:block; width:770px; height:100px; background-image:url(images/rep_1.gif); background-color:#333333;  margin:0; padding:5px; /*border:1px solid #ffffff; border-right:3px solid #ffffff;*/}
#header h1 { text-indent:0px; padding:0; margin:10px 0 3px 0; font-family:Georgia, "Times New Roman", Times, serif; color:#657C1E; font-weight:bold; font-size:50px; letter-spacing:0px; font-style:italic; line-height:50px; text-align:center;}
#header h2 { text-indent:0px; margin:2px 0 3px 0; padding:0; color:#657C1E; font-family:Georgia, "Times New Roman", Times, serif; font-weight:bold; font-size:20px; letter-spacing:0px; font-style:italic; text-align:center;}/**/

#body { display:block; width:780px; height:inherit; margin:5px; padding:0; clear:both; }

.clearfix:after {	content: ".";	display: block;	height: 0;	clear: both;	visibility: hidden; }
.clearfix { display: inline-block; }
/* Hides from IE-mac \*/
* html .clearfix { height: 1%; }
.clearfix {	display: block; }

#middle { display:block; width:537px; height:inherit; margin:0; padding:15px 15px 0 15px; float:left; background-color:#ffffff; border-right:2px solid #ffffff; }
#middle h1 { display:block; width:540px; height:40px; text-align:center; color:#475811; font-family:Georgia, Verdana, Arial, Helvetica, sans-serif; font-size:25px; background-image:url(../images/back_middle_h1.jpg); margin:auto; margin-bottom:5px; margin-top:75px; padding:0; }
#middle h2 { font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-weight:bold; font-size:14px; color:#475811; margin:10px 0 10px 0; padding:0; }
#middle h3 { font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-weight:bold; font-size:12px; color:#475811; margin:10px 0 10px 0; padding:0; }
#middle p {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; color:#475811; margin:0 0 10px 0; padding:0; }
#middle a { font-weight:bold; color:#333333; text-decoration:none; } 
#middle ol { list-style-image:url(images/bullet.gif); font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; color:#475811; margin:4px 15px 10px 30px; padding:0; }
/*#middle ul { font-family:Verdana, Arial Helvetica, sans-serif; font-size:13px; margin:10px 0 30px 0; padding:0; font-weight:bold; }
#middle li { color:#c54b1d; list-style-image:url(../images/point_1.jpg); margin:5px 0px 0 20px; padding:0; }
#middle ol { font-family:Verdana, Arial Helvetica, sans-serif; font-size:13px; margin:10px 0 30px 0; padding:0; font-weight:bold; }
*/

.ordered_list { margin:10px; }

#featured {width:80%; height:inherit; margin:auto; padding:0;}
#featured a {text-decoration:underline;}

#builderBox { display:block;	background-color:#e6e2c5; width:500px; height:relative;	margin:auto;	margin-top:20px;	margin-bottom:10px;	padding:0 0 5px 0; border:1px solid #d3d2b6; clear:both; }
#builderBox h2{ display:block; background-color:#d3d2b6;	width:100%;	height:20px;	text-align:center;	font-size:14px;	font-family:Tahoma, Arial, Helvetica, sans-serif;	font-weight:bold;	color:#657c1e;	margin:0;	padding:0; }
#builderBox p{ margin:5px 10px 5px 10px;	padding:0;	font-size:13px;	font-family:Tahoma, Arial, Helvetica, sans-serif;	color:#657c1e; }
.dynlink { font-size:14px;	font-weight:bold;	color:#c54b1d; cursor:pointer; cursor:hand; color:#660000;}

#navigation { display:block; width:190px; height:inherit; margin:0 0 0 0; padding:5px 10px 5px 5px; float:right; /*background-color:#D4A352;*/}
#navigation h4 { width:170px; height:15px; /*background-image:url(../images/nav_header.jpg); text-transform:uppercase; */ font-family:Georgia, Arial, Serif; font-weight:bold; font-size:14px; color:#FFFFFF; padding:5px; text-align:center; margin:0 5px 10px 5px; background-color:#657C1E;  }
#navigation ul { font-family:Georgia, Arial, Serif; font-size:13px; margin:10px 0 30px 0; padding:0; }
#navigation li { color:#c54b1d; list-style-image:url(../images/arrows.gif); margin:5px 0px 0 25px; padding:0; }
#navigation a { color:#FFFFFF; text-decoration:underline; margin:0; padding:0; font-weight:bold; }
#navigation a:hover { background-color:#657C1E; margin:0; padding:2px; }
#navigation a:active { color:#ffffff; margin:0; padding:0; }
#navigation p { font-family:Georgia, Arial, Serif; font-size:12px; /*font-weight:bold;*/ color:#475811; margin:0 0 20px 0; padding:0; text-align:center; }

.panel { font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#000000; margin:0; padding:0; }

#bottom { width:100%; height:140px; background-image:url(../images/bottom_back.jpg); margin:0; padding:0;}
#bottom p { font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:10px; color:#c54b1d; text-align:center; margin:0; padding:0; text-transform:uppercase;}

#footer { display:block; width:770px; height:15px; background-color:#D3D2B6; border-top:1px solid #ffffff; margin:auto; padding:5px 5px; font-size:10px; color:#706F53; text-align:center; }
#footer a { color:#706F53; font-family:Arial, Helvetica, sans-serif; font-weight:bold; }

#copyright { width:780px; height:30px; margin:0 auto; padding:0; font-family:Verdana, Arial Helvetica, sans-serif; font-size:12px; text-align:center; background-image:url(images/bg1.jpg); }
#copyright p { color:#000000; text-decoration:none; font-size:11px; font-family:Arial, Helvetica, sans-serif; margin:10px 0px; padding:0; }
#copyright a { color:#6699CC; text-decoration:none; font-size:11px; font-family:Arial, Helvetica, sans-serif; font-weight:bold; text-decoration:underline; }

#ad { display:block; width:100%; height:inherit; margin:auto; padding:0; margin-top:10px; margin-bottom:10px; text-align:center; }
#ad2 { display:block; width:530px; height:65px; margin:auto; padding:0; margin-top:10px; margin-bottom:10px; text-align:center; }
#ad3 { display:block; width:400px; height:280px; margin:auto; padding:0; margin-top:10px; margin-bottom:10px; text-align:center; }

.img { border:1px solid #000000; }
.img2 { border:2px solid #ffffff; margin:10px 10px 10px 10px; text-align:center; }

/*-----------------------------------------------------------------------*/
/*--------------------|                           |----------------------*/
/*--------------------|    Hide / Show Toggle     |----------------------*/
/*--------------------|                           |----------------------*/
/*-----------------------------------------------------------------------*/

.advsearch { position:relative; top:8px; left:110px; font-family:Arial, Helvetica, sans-serif; font-weight:bold; font-size:12px; color:#FFFFCC; }
.advsearch a:visited {color:#FFFFFF;}

#hideshow {position:absolute; top: 50%; left: 50%; margin-left:-340px; margin-top:-180px; z-index:100; background-color:#E6E2C5; border:5px solid #D3D2B6; width:650px; height:360px; color:#657C1E; text-align:center; padding:5px 5px 5px 5px; font-family:Arial, Helvitica, Serif; font-size:14px;}
#hideshow a {color:#000000; margin:0; padding:0;}
#hideshow p {width:640px; margin:3px 5px 5px 5px; text-align:left;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; color:#657C1E; padding:0; }
#hideshow h1 {display:block; width:680px; height:40px; text-align:center; color:#657C1E; font-family:Georgia, "Times New Roman", Times, serif; font-size:28px; margin:5px 0 10px 0; padding:0; text-align:center; font-style:italic; }
